Key Considerations When Buying a Treadmill
Before dedicating to a treadmill purchase, it is important to consider various aspects that can impact your fulfillment and physical fitness results. Below are important elements to evaluate:
Type of Treadmill
Manual Treadmills: Powered by the user's motion, requiring no electrical power. Perfect for light walking and affordable choices.Motorized Treadmills: Equipped with electric motors that provide various speeds and slope settings, making them appropriate for running and intensive training.
Treadmill Size and Space
Think about the measurements of your exercise area. Measure the space to validate that the treadmill will fit conveniently.Collapsible treadmills can be a fantastic option for those with limited area, as they can be kept away when not in usage.
Key Features
Motor Power: Measured in horse power (HP), a greater HP offers better performance, particularly for running.Running Surface: The length and width of the belt matter. A longer surface is necessary for running, while a shorter belt might be adequate for walking.Slope Options: Adjustable slopes include range to workouts and target various muscle groups.
Resilience and Build Quality
Try to find a treadmill constructed from high-quality products. Read evaluations and consider service warranties, which can show the toughness of the machine.
Rate and Budget
Treadmills can differ substantially in cost. Set a budget plan that balances your requirements, functions, and brand name reliability.
Extra Features

What is the very best treadmill for home use?
The best treadmill for home use mostly depends on private preferences and needs. For running enthusiasts, a motorized treadmill with an effective motor is suggested. For those with minimal space or budget plan, a manual treadmill can be enough.
2. Just how much should I invest on a treadmill?
Treadmills range from ₤ 100 for fundamental manual designs to over ₤ 3000 for high-end motorized alternatives. A budget of ₤ 500 to ₤ 1500 can yield a quality motorized treadmill with great functions.
3. What function is crucial for a treadmill?
A dependable motor and a comfy running surface area are among the most crucial features. In addition, slope alternatives and user-friendly controls can improve the workout experience.
4. Are collapsible treadmills worth it?
Yes, collapsible treadmills are excellent space-saving solutions and deserve thinking about for those with restricted space. Make sure to inspect the construct quality to ensure stability when in use.
5. How can I preserve my treadmill?
Regularly wipe down the machine after usage, keep the running surface area without dust, and inspect the belt tension according to the producer's standards. Regular lubrication of the deck may likewise be required.
